Problem overview

Some Jaguar S-Type owners report experiencing persistent seatbelt alarm issues even when all seatbelts are secured. A common cause of this problem is faulty wiring or connection, which can prevent the seat belt sensor from properly detecting whether the seat belt is fastened, resulting in a constant beeping sound. Additionally, some owners have found success in disabling the seatbelt alarm through specific procedures, such as a sequence of fastening and releasing the seat belt. In certain cases, using a scan tool can also help deactivate the seatbelt chime by accessing the car's system. If the seatbelt warning lamp remains illuminated during the alarm, it may indicate a problem with the seatbelt circuit, necessitating further diagnosis. For those who continue to experience issues despite these troubleshooting steps, consulting a professional mechanic or Jaguar dealership is recommended for a thorough inspection and resolution of the underlying problem.
